Re: (ASCEND) PPTP via P75



With Win98, 

Start -> Programs -> Accessories -> Communications -> Dia-up Networking
make a New Connection -> Select a device -> Microsoft VPN Adapter
and follow the rest of the screens (workes for me over a NAT connection
to the office - I was impressed (possibly the first time with a Windows
Networking first...)
